mysql 连接命令

235 2023-12-06 18:26

使用MySQL连接命令进行数据处理和管理

MySQL是一种强大的关系型数据库管理系统,广泛应用于各种Web应用程序和数据驱动的网站。使用MySQL连接命令,可以轻松地处理和管理数据库中的数据。在本篇文章中,我们将介绍一些基本的MySQL连接命令,以帮助您更好地理解和利用MySQL数据库。

建立数据库连接

要开始在MySQL中进行数据处理和管理操作,首先需要建立与数据库的连接。我们可以使用以下命令进行连接:

mysql -u your_username -p your_password

这个命令中的your_username是您的MySQL用户名,而your_password是您的密码。通过执行这个连接命令,您将能够进入MySQL的命令行界面,并开始进行各种数据库操作。

选择数据库

连接数据库成功后,接下来可以选择要操作的特定数据库。使用以下命令选择数据库:

USE database_name;

在这个命令中,您需要将database_name替换为您要操作的实际数据库名称。执行这个命令后,您将进入所选择的数据库中,并可以执行各种针对该数据库的操作。

执行SQL查询

一旦连接到特定数据库,您可以使用MySQL连接命令来执行各种SQL查询。下面是一些常见的查询命令示例:

SELECT column1, column2 FROM table_name;

这个命令用于从一个名为table_name的表中选择column1column2这两列的数据。您可以根据实际情况修改表名和列名以适应您的数据库结构。

UPDATE table_name SET column1 = 'value' WHERE condition;

通过这个命令,您可以在表中根据条件更新指定列的值。您需要将table_name替换为实际表名,将column1替换为要更新的列,将value替换为新值,并根据需要提供适当的条件。

DELETE FROM table_name WHERE condition;

这个命令用于从表中根据条件删除数据行。将table_name替换为实际表名,并提供适用的条件以确定要删除的行。

创建和管理表格

使用MySQL连接命令,您可以创建新的数据表,并对现有表进行管理。以下是一些常用的表格创建和管理命令示例:

CREATE TABLE table_name (column1 datatype, column2 datatype, column3 datatype);

这个命令用于创建一个名为table_name的新表格。您需要定义每个列的名称和数据类型。可以根据实际需求扩展列的数量和类型。

ALTER TABLE table_name ADD column_name datatype;

通过这个命令,您可以向现有表中添加一个新的列。用table_name替换实际表名,用column_name替换要添加的列名,用datatype替换新列的数据类型。

DROP TABLE table_name;

这个命令用于删除指定的表。您需要将table_name替换为要删除的实际表名。请注意,执行这个命令将永久删除整个表及其数据,所以要谨慎使用。

导入和导出数据

使用MySQL连接命令,您还可以方便地导入和导出数据,以便在不同的数据库之间传递数据。以下是一些常见的数据导入和导出命令示例:

LOAD DATA INFILE 'file_name' INTO TABLE table_name;

通过这个命令,您可以将一个名为file_name的文件中的数据导入到指定的表中。用table_name替换实际表名,并确保文件路径和名称正确。

SELECT column1, column2 INTO OUTFILE 'file_name' FROM table_name;

这个命令将从表中选择指定列的数据,并将其导出到一个名为file_name的文件中。您需要替换表名和列名,以及指定正确的导出文件路径。

断开数据库连接

当您完成对数据库的操作后,可以使用以下命令断开与MySQL数据库的连接:

EXIT;

通过执行这个命令,您将安全地退出MySQL命令行界面,并断开与数据库的连接。

结论

MySQL连接命令是处理和管理数据库中数据的重要工具。通过建立数据库连接、选择数据库、执行SQL查询、创建和管理表格、导入和导出数据等操作,您可以更好地利用MySQL数据库的强大功能。希望本文提供的信息能够帮助您更好地理解和应用MySQL连接命令。祝您在数据库操作中取得更好的成果!

顶一下
(0)
0%
踩一下
(0)
0%
相关评论
我要评论
点击我更换图片